Question
Solve for x:
`2^(3x + 3) = 2^(3x + 1) + 48`

Solution
`2^(3x + 3) = 2^(3x + 1) + 48`
⇒ 23x 23 = 23x21 + 48
⇒ 23x 8 - 23x × 2 = 48
⇒ 23x (8 - 2) = 48
⇒ 23x × 6 = 48
⇒ 23x = `48/6`
⇒ 23x = 8
⇒ 23x = 23
⇒ 3x = 3
⇒ x = `3/3`
⇒ x = 1
